Email Marketing Mishaps: Avoiding Courthouse Blocks & Enforcement

Navigating the realm of email advertising can be tricky , and ignoring regulations can lead to serious repercussions . A few seemingly minor mistake – like failing to obtain explicit consent, neglecting to provide an easy unsubscribe method , or sending spam messages – can quickly land your organization facing legal action from regulatory bodies . These actions can range from warnings to substantial fines , and even court orders effectively halting your email efforts . Proactive compliance with laws like GDPR and CAN-SPAM is crucial for preventing these potentially devastating results and maintaining a healthy sender image .

Inbox Zero Nightmare: Recovering from a Blocked Email Campaign

Suddenly finding your mailbox overflowing with rejected messages after a massive email send can be a terrifying experience – the dreaded "Inbox Zero Nightmare." This typically happens when your messaging system gets identified as a source of unwanted correspondence, leading to significant blocking by services. Correcting this situation requires immediate action, including verifying your transmitting reputation, cleaning your subscriber database of bad addresses, and getting in touch with your hosting firm to settle the issue and reinstate proper message transmission .
